Upon the findings of this work, further topics might be investigated in the future.
|
||||
|
||||
Generally, the performances of both helper-data algorithms might be tested on larger datasets.
|
||||
|
||||
Specifically concerning the BACH method, instead of using only $plus.minus 1$ as weights for the linear combinations, fractional weights could be used instead as they could provide more flexibility for the outcome of the linear combinations.
|
||||
In the same sense, a more efficient method to find the optimal linear combination might exist.
|
||||
|
||||
During the iterative process of the center point approximation in BACH, a way may be found to increase the distance between all optimal points $bold(cal(o))$ to achieve a better separation for the results of the linear combinations in every quantizer bin.
